POST OFFICE NOTICES.
PAPANCI,
A Post'OfSce has been opened at Papanui at Mr Haskins' Store; it will ba open daily, Sundays ex cepted, from 10 a.m. to 4 ( p.m.
KAIAPOI,
In future the office hours at the Post Office at Kaiapoi will be from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.
EANGIORA. The office hours at Rangiora will be from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.; excepting on Mondays and Thursdays, when it will be open from 10 a.m. to 7 p.m.. and on Tuesdays and Fridays from 9 to 10 a.m., and 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. Letters posted in Lytteiton before half-past 8 a.m. on Mondays and Thursdays are forwarded to Papanni, Kaiapol and Rangiora on the same days. A mail for Timaru closes at Christchurch every alternate Wednesday. Letters posted at Lyttelton before half-past 8 on the mail day are in time to be forwarded by it. P. E. WRIGHT, Postmaster.
